The Great Equalizer: Technology Meets Talent
The evolution of SIM racing from a niche hobby into a legitimate talent pipeline is a classic disruptor narrative. Modern simulators aren't toys; they are precision instruments. With laser-scanned tracks and physics engines that calculate tire deformation and brake temperature in real-time, the data doesn't lie. When a driver masters a lap at Spa-Francorchamps in a virtual environment, the cognitive load and the technical demands are almost identical to the physical world.
This technological leap has created a direct skill transferability. The best drivers react to visual cues, minute vibrations, and telemetry data. In the sim, they accumulate thousands of hours of practice that would cost millions in fuel, tires, and track fees in the real world. They are building the muscle memory, the analytical mindset, and the tactical intuition required to compete at the highest level.

The Physics of Translation: Virtual to Real
The transition is often met with skepticism from traditionalists. How can someone who has never felt the G-forces of a real car compete with those who have spent their lives on the track? The answer lies in the evidence-based results we see every day.
Take the case of drivers who have spent their formative years in simulators and then stepped into a real-world cockpit for the first time. The results are often staggering. Because they have already mastered the "mental" side of racing: the racing lines, the braking points, the fuel management: they only have to adapt to the physical sensations.
They aren't learning how to race; they are simply learning how to feel what they already know. Their lap times drop rapidly. Their feedback to engineers is precise and technical. They demonstrate a level of sophistication that usually takes years of on-track experience to develop.
This isn't an accident. It’s the logical result of focused, consistent commitment. The simulator has allowed them to "pre-load" their expertise. By the time they hit the pavement, they aren't rookies; they are seasoned competitors in a new environment. Reality is simply catching up to their potential.
